WebMillimeter. Definition: A millimeter (symbol: mm) is a unit of length in the International System of Units (SI). It is defined in terms of the meter, as 1/1000 of a meter, or the distance traveled by light in 1/299 792 458 000 of a second. Web2 dec. 2011 · The mm of a lens is the focal length. To take close-up shots of things far away, you need a "long" focal length, which means high mm. An entry or mid-level Canon camera has an "APS-C" sized sensor. The sensor size is really what determines what the meaning of the focal length is — focal length and sensor size together give you angle of … Web17 sep. 2010 · Minimum shooting distance is different from the focal length. Focal length relates with the angle of view. 30 mm in most dSLRs (Nikon, Sony and Pentax) will give you something similar with what your eyes can see (of course the camera works totally different than your eyes but it's a good equivalence). So 18 mm is wider than the eye normal view ...
